Abstract

The invention relates to an external wall fireproof heat preservation plate, which consists of a fiberglass gridding cloth and magnesia cement composite reinforced layer, a silicate cotton plate heat preservation layer and reinforcement isolation layers, and is characterized in that the fiberglass gridding cloth and magnesia cement composite reinforced layer is arranged outside the external wall fireproof heat preservation plate, and the silicate cotton plate heat preservation layer is filled inside the external wall fireproof heat preservation plate; and the reinforcement isolation layers are longitudinally and transversely staggered and uniformly distributed in the silicate cotton plate heat preservation layer. The reinforcement isolation layers are uniformly arranged or longitudinally and transversely staggered and uniformly arranged to form three forms of triangular uniform arrangement. The external wall fireproof heat preservation plates of different specifications, sizes and shapes can be manufactured by disposable template filling according to a requirement of a building; industrial production of building materials can be realized; the construction speed is greatly increased; the problems of short service life and low fireproof performance of the conventional external wall heat preservation material are solved; the production cost of the external heat preservation wall plate is greatly reduced; the external wall fireproof heat preservation plate is convenient to construct; and quality can be guaranteed.

Technical field
The invention belongs to building material technical field, particularly a kind of fireproof heat insulation plate of outer wall that can be widely used in industry and civilian construction.
Background technology
At present, domestic in building field External Walls Heating Insulation also not bery perfect, wherein mostly adopt outer sticky benzene plate system as produced when body of wall external pasting benzene plate, phenolic resins plate, extruded sheet, cement and granular polystyrene plate etc. are not prevented fires, burnt in order to solve exterior-wall heat insulation the defects such as poison gas, easily fusing, intensity difference, application life is short.Adopt in addition light steel skeleton heat-insulation system or polyurethane foam technology, although light steel skeleton heat-insulation system has solved the defect of above-mentioned existence, but due to this cement foaming material and cement-bonded intensity difference, after cement is dry, can produce gap, therefore affect its application life, especially be not suitable for the area that the northern temperature difference is large and use, also, because its cost is high, be difficult to promote the use of.

the specific embodiment
Fireproof heat insulation plate of outer wall of the present invention is achieved in that below in conjunction with accompanying drawing and illustrates.Fireproof heat insulation plate of outer wall of the present invention, by: fiberglass gridding cloth and magnesia cement composite strengthening skin 1, the cotton plate insulation layer 2 of silicate and reinforcement interlayer 3 form, the outside of fireproof heat insulation plate of outer wall is fiberglass gridding cloth magnesia cement composite strengthening skin 1, in it, fill the cotton plate insulation layer 2 of silicate, in the cotton plate insulation layer 2 of silicate, be provided with the staggered reinforcement interlayer 3 being evenly arranged of longitudinal and transverse direction.
See Fig. 1, strengthen interlayer 3 and be longitudinally and be evenly arranged in the cotton plate insulation layer 2 of silicate.
See Fig. 2, strengthen interlayer 3 and in the cotton plate insulation layer 2 of silicate, be that longitudinal and transverse direction is staggered to be evenly arranged.
See Fig. 3, strengthen interlayer 3 the cotton plate insulation layer of silicate 2 interior triangular in shape being evenly arranged.
Magnesia cement in fiberglass gridding cloth and magnesia cement composite strengthening skin 1 adopts magnesium chloride, magnesia, flyash, wood chip, granular polystyrene, floats pearl, sepiolite, silicate of soda, bleeding agent and waterproof agent is that raw material and water break into pulpous state in right amount, then with compound fiberglass gridding cloth and the magnesia cement composite strengthening skin 1 made of fiberglass gridding cloth; It is that raw material is made that the cotton plate insulation layer 2 of silicate adopts asbestos wool, glue, bleeding agent and waterproof agent; Strengthening interlayer 3 employing fiberglass gridding cloths, magnesium chloride, magnesia, flyash and bleeding agent is that raw material is made.
Magnesia cement is got raw material by the percentage of quality: magnesium chloride 20%, magnesia 20%, flyash 40%, wood chip 5%, granular polystyrene 4%, float pearl 4%, sepiolite 4%, silicate of soda 1%, bleeding agent 1% and waterproof agent 1%; The described cotton plate insulation layer of silicate 2 Raws are to get by the percentage of quality: asbestos wool 80%, glue 10%, bleeding agent 5%, waterproof agent 5%, break into pulpous state, and at 200 ℃ of hyperthermia dryings, make; Raw material in described reinforcement interlayer 3 is to get by the percentage of quality: magnesium chloride 30%, magnesia 30% flyash 40% break into pulpous state, are combined with each other and make with fiberglass gridding cloth.
The present invention can be according to the requirement of building, adopt disposable template filling to make the fire-proof composite heat preservation board for external wall of different size, size, shape, can realize the suitability for industrialized production of constructional materials, greatly improved speed of application, solved short, the problem such as fireproof performance is poor in current external-wall heat-insulation material application life, and greatly reducing the cost of production of outer insulated wall plate, easy construction, ensures the quality of products.
Fireproof heat insulation plate of outer wall of the present invention, detects through national building materials inspection center: hydrophobic rate (core) 98.8%; Coefficient of thermal conductivity (core) 0.044W/(m.k), average temperature: 68.9 ℃; 7 ℃ of average temperature risings, mass loss 33%, combustion heat value 0.3MJ/ ㎏ in combustibility (surface layer) stove; 6 ℃ of average temperature risings, mass loss 15%, combustion heat value 0.3MJ/ ㎏ in combustibility (core) stove; Density (composite plate) 153 ㎏/m 3, all meeting the technical requirement of A1 level in GB8624-2006, submitted sample surface layer and core combustibility all reach A1 level.
